     /*=================================中小型笔记本或大平板 laptop /*=================================*/
    @media screen and (max-width: 1200px) {

		

    }



















    /*=================================手机或小平板 phone=============================== */
    @media screen and (max-width: 767px) {
  
		.menu{
                display: block;
                position: absolute;
                right:4%;
                top:calc(32% - 5px);
             }
            .menu_down{
                position:fixed;
                left:0;
                z-index: 9999999;
                width: 100%;
                height: 100%;
                top:0;
                padding-bottom: 22px;
                background:rgba(245,245,245,0.8);
              }
            .menu_down li{
                line-height:50px;
                text-align: center;
                border-bottom: 1px solid rgba(255,255,255,.2);
                padding-left:10%;
                }

            .menu_down li a{
                display: block;
                font-size: 16px;
                color: #000;
                text-align:left;
             }
             .menu_down li.active{
                background:#f77946;
             }
             .menu_down li.active a{
                padding-left:6%;
                color: #fff;
             }
            .menu span.icon-bar{
                background:#f77946;
                width: 18px;
                height: 3px;
                display: block;
                -webkit-transition: all 300ms ease-out; 
                -moz-transition: all 300ms ease-out;
                transition: all 300ms ease-out; 
            }
            .menu .sr-only{
                display: none;
            }
            .menu .icon-bar:nth-child(2){
                -webkit-transform: rotate(0deg) translate(0,0);
                -moz-transform: rotate(0deg) translate(0,0);
                -ms-transform: rotate(0deg) translate(0,0);
                transform: rotate(0deg) translate(0,0);
                transform-origin:top left;
            }
            .menu .icon-bar:nth-child(3){
                margin-top:4px; 
                -webkit-transform: scale(1,1);
                -moz-transform: scale(1,1);
                -ms-transform: scale(1,1);
                transform: scale(1,1);
                -webkit-transform-origin: center center;
                -moz-transform-origin: center center;
                -ms-transform-origin: center center;
                transform-origin: center center;
            }
            .menu .icon-bar:nth-child(4){
                margin-top:4px; 
                -webkit-transform: rotate(0deg) translate(0,0);
                -moz-transform: rotate(0deg) translate(0,0);
                -ms-transform: rotate(0deg) translate(0,0);
                transform: rotate(0deg) translate(0,0);
                transform-origin:top left;
            }
            .header{
                height:auto;
                padding-top: 0;
                position: relative;
                padding:3% 0;
            }
            .nav{
                display: none;
            }
            .nav_menu{
                position:initial;
                height:50px;
                float: right;
                padding-top: 20px;
                padding-right: 20px;
            }
            .menu_down ul{
                margin-top: 50px;
            }
            .header .flex{
            	-webkit-flex-wrap: wrap;
            	flex-wrap: wrap;
            }
            .logo{
            	max-width:150px;
            }
            .search {
            	margin-top: 4%;
            }
            .banner{
            	height:290px;
            }
            .w1200{
            	width: 92%;
            	margin: 0 auto;
            }
            .module_page1{
            	padding-top: 6%;
            }
            .quality_list li{
            	width: 48%;
            	margin-bottom: 4%;
            	height: 220px;
            }
            .quality_list li .img{
            	width: 100%;
            }
            .quality_list li p{
            	margin-top: 6%;
            }
            .index_title h4{
            	font-size: 18px;
            	font-weight: 400;
            }
            .index_title h3{
            	font-size: 18px;
            }
            .module_page3{
            	padding: 5% 0;
            }
            .product_list{
            	padding:0;
            }
            .product_list li{
            	width: 48.5%;
            }
            .product_list li figcaption{
            	bottom:0;
            }
            .proqul_list li figure{
            	height:200px;
            	width: 100%;
            }
            .proqul_list li{
            	width: 100%;
            	padding:2%;
            }
            .proqul_list li figcaption{
            	width: 100%;
            	height: 100%;
            	left:0;
            	top:0;
            }
            .proqul_list{
            	margin-bottom: 4%;
            }
            .module_page4{
            	padding:4% 0 6% 0;
            }
            .module_page6{
            	padding:10% 0 5% 0;
            	background-size:cover;
            	height:auto;
            }
            .module_page6 p{
            	font-size: 15px;
            	margin-bottom: 10%;
            }
            .wenzi_list li{
            	width: 40%;
            	height: 80px;
            	line-height:60px;
            	margin-bottom:8%;
            	margin-right:8%;
            }
            .wenzi_list li:nth-child(2n){
            	margin-right: 0;
            }
            .wenzi_list ul{
            	-webkit-justify-content: center;
            	justify-content: center;
            }
            .index_title{
            	height:110px;
            }
            .pro_nav li{
            	width: 30%;
            }
            .pro_nav li a{
            	min-width:inherit;
            	width: 100%;
            }
            .product_list3 li{
            	width: 48%;
            }
            .module_page10 .flex{
            	-webkit-flex-wrap: wrap;
            	flex-wrap: wrap;
            }
            .news_list{
            	width: 100%;
            }
            .news_list li{
            	width: 100%;
            	padding-bottom: 10px;
            }
            .news_list li p{
            	overflow : hidden;
				text-overflow: ellipsis;
				display: -webkit-box;
				-webkit-line-clamp: 2;
				-webkit-box-orient: vertical;
				padding-bottom: 0;
            }
            .news_swiper{
            	width: 100%;
            	height:240px;
            }
            .f_milde{
            	display: none;
            }
            .f_logo{
            	display: none;
            }
            .ewm{
            	display: none;
            }
            .footer{
            	padding:2% 0;
            }
            .about_deta {
            	-webkit-flex-wrap: wrap;
            	flex-wrap: wrap;
            }
            .about_deta .left{
            	width: 100%;
            	height:auto;
            	padding:6% 4%;
            }
            .about_deta .right{
            	width: 100%;
            	height:auto;
            	padding:6% 4%;
            }
            .about_deta .left h3{
            	font-size: 24px;
            	line-height:40px;
            }
            .about_deta .left p{
            	margin-top: 8%;
            }
            .product_nav li{
            	margin:0 5%;
            	width: 40%;
            	margin-bottom: 5%;
            }
            .product_nav li a{
            	width: 100%;
            	line-height:44px;
            	text-align: center;
            }
            .product_nav ul{
            	-webkit-flex-wrap: wrap;
            	flex-wrap: wrap;
            }
            .detail{
            	padding-top:8%;
            }
            .inside_title{
            	font-size: 26px;
            	margin-bottom: 6%;
            }
            .inside_pro li{
            	width: 48%;
            	margin-right: 4%;
            }
            .inside_pro li:nth-child(2n){
            	margin-right: 0;
            }
            .por_page{
            	padding:0;
            }
            .prodea_top{
            	-webkit-flex-wrap: wrap;
            	flex-wrap: wrap;
            }
            .prodea_right{
            	width: 100%;
            	padding:0;
            	margin-top: 6%;
            }
            .prodea_swiper{
            	width: 100%;
            	height:345px;
            }
            .prodea_right h3{
            	margin-right: 0;
            }
            .pro_endit{
            	margin-top: 0;
            }
            .newsdea_title h3{
                font-size: 24px;
            }
            .newsdea_title p{
                width: 75%;
                margin: 0 auto;
            }
            .detailSet{
                margin:5% auto;
                height:auto;
                font-size: 15px;
                font-family: Verdana, Tahoma, å®‹ä½“;
            }
            .message{
            	width: 100%;
            	margin-left: 0;
            }
            .map{
            	width: 100%;
            	margin-right: 0;
            	margin-top: 8%;
            }
            .contact_page {
            	-webkit-flex-wrap: wrap;
            	flex-wrap: wrap;
            }
    }








